LATOUR-GIRAUD - Puligny-Montrachet 1er cru Champs Canet - 2011

LATOUR-GIRAUD

Puligny-Montrachet 1er cru Champs Canet 2011

- 93 points -

An exuberantly fresh nose offers up notes of pear, peach, apricot, green apple and wet stone where the latter element can also be found on the opulent, intense and well-detailed flavors that are blessed with plenty of palate coating dry extract. There is excellent underlying tension to the tangy and citrus-infused finish that possesses both outstanding depth and persistence. This doesn't have the sheer minerality of the Perrières but it is just as long. A qualitative choice.

Allen Meadows, June 2013
